Igbo politicians calling for restructuring are cowardice.: MASSOB-BIM


The Movement for the Actualisation of the Sovereign State of Biafra- Biafra Independence Movement (MASSOB-BIM) says it is not in support of the call for restructuring of the country as being put forward by politicians from the South East geopolitical zone, describing the call as an act of cowardice.

According to a statement endorsed by Anselam Ogbonna, zonal Information Director, Abia Central zone of the group, these set of politicians forget to seek the minds of people who they represent before making such utterances.

The statement which was made available to newsmen in Umuahia, the Abia State capital, reads in part: “Are they calling for restructuring while the people they are owing salaries are aggrieved over their nonchalant attitude towards the electorate who, given the opportunity, will stone them to death.

Instead of them to have the pertinent feeling on how to address the problems of the masses, rather they are busy clamouring for restructuring because of their selfish interests”.

The group had insisted that these people do not really know what they want, stating that such people are on their own, even as it recalled that it was the same call made by the late Biafra leader, Chief Emeka Odumegwu Ojukwu, in 1966 which the then Head of State, General Yakubu Gowon, refused to heed to at that time.

The group was not happy that even with Boko Haram sect fighting for 19 states out of the 36 states of the country; OPC and Afenifere in the West agitating for Oduduwa republic; Niger Delta militants from South-South calling for resource control and MASSOB -BIM in the South East calling for Biafra, the politicians are busy campaigning for restructuring of the country.

They alleged that the same politicians had earlier attempted to hijack the Biafra struggle without success, hence the turn around to back the restructuring agitation.
The group therefore asked them to stop deceiving themselves and others.

They should stop suffering people since they don’t have any good agenda for the masses. What we are talking about is a total Biafra freedom from Nigeria and there is no going back on it.

They should go and restructure their bedrooms and stop deceiving the people”, the group further warned.
